首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

将参数传递给更新存储在react-redux中的方法

是通过调用action creator函数并传递参数来实现的。在react-redux中,action creator函数是用于创建action对象的函数,它们返回一个包含type和payload属性的对象,其中type表示要执行的操作类型,payload表示要传递的数据。

在更新存储的方法中,可以通过调用action creator函数并传递参数来创建一个action对象。然后,通过调用redux中的dispatch函数将该action对象发送到redux store中。redux store会根据action对象的type属性来执行相应的reducer函数,从而更新存储中的数据。

下面是一个示例代码,演示如何将参数传递给更新存储在react-redux中的方法:

  1. 创建action creator函数:// 定义一个action creator函数,接收参数并返回一个action对象 const updateData = (data) => { return { type: 'UPDATE_DATA', payload: data }; };
  2. 在组件中调用action creator函数并传递参数:import { connect } from 'react-redux'; import { updateData } from './actions'; class MyComponent extends React.Component { // ... handleUpdateData = (data) => { // 调用action creator函数并传递参数 this.props.updateData(data); } // ... } // 将action creator函数映射到组件的props中 const mapDispatchToProps = { updateData }; export default connect(null, mapDispatchToProps)(MyComponent);

在上述示例中,我们首先定义了一个名为updateData的action creator函数,它接收一个参数data并返回一个包含type和payload属性的action对象。然后,在组件中通过调用this.props.updateData(data)来调用该action creator函数并传递参数。

通过上述步骤,我们成功地将参数传递给更新存储在react-redux中的方法。当调用updateData函数时,redux store会根据action对象的type属性执行相应的reducer函数,从而更新存储中的数据。

注意:以上示例中的action type和reducer函数需要根据具体的应用场景进行定义和实现。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

6分33秒

048.go的空接口

2分25秒

090.sync.Map的Swap方法

3分52秒

AIoT应用创新大赛-基于TencentOS Tiny 的介绍植物生长分析仪视频

1分19秒

020-MyBatis教程-动态代理使用例子

14分15秒

021-MyBatis教程-parameterType使用

3分49秒

022-MyBatis教程-传参-一个简单类型

7分8秒

023-MyBatis教程-MyBatis是封装的jdbc操作

8分36秒

024-MyBatis教程-命名参数

15分31秒

025-MyBatis教程-使用对象传参

6分21秒

026-MyBatis教程-按位置传参

6分44秒

027-MyBatis教程-Map传参

15分6秒

028-MyBatis教程-两个占位符比较

领券